Cisco IOS XE Software Web UI Cross-Site WebSocket Hijacking Vulnerability
vendor_cisco·2021-03-24·CVSS 7.4
CVE-2021-1403 [HIGH] CWE-345 Cisco IOS XE Software Web UI Cross-Site WebSocket Hijacking Vulnerability
Cisco IOS XE Software Web UI Cross-Site WebSocket Hijacking Vulnerability
A vulnerability in the web UI feature of Cisco IOS XE Software could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to conduct a cross-site WebSocket hijacking (CSWSH) attack and cause a denial of service (DoS) condition on an affected device.
This vulnerability is due to insufficient HTTP protections in the web UI on an affected device.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by persuading an authenticated user of the web UI to follow a crafted link. A successful exploit could allow the attacker to corrupt memory on the affected device, forcing it to reload and causing a DoS condition.
Cisco has released software updates that address this vulnerability. There are no workarounds that address this vulnerability.

## Vulnerability Spotlight: Vulnerabilities in Moxa MXView could allow attacker to view sensitive information, bypass login
Patrick DeSantis of Cisco Talos discovered these vulnerabilities.
Cisco Talos recently discovered two vulnerabilities in Moxa's MXview network management software that could allow an attacker to view sensitive data or bypass the need to log into the device.
MXview is designed for users to configure, monitor and diagnose networking devices connected to networks in industrial control system environments.
TALOS-2021-1403 (CVE-2021-40392) exists in MXview’s web application. An attacker could sniff traffic and gain the appropriate information to then exploit the vulnerability and view unencrypted network communication.
